For a standard garage door opener replacement in the Atlanta area, homeowners should typically expect to pay between $300 and $600 for the unit and professional installation. This cost generally covers a basic 1/2 HP chain-drive motor. If you require a quieter belt-drive model or a unit with a backup battery, the price can rise to $700 or more. Labor fees usually account for $150 to $250 of the total. However, if your garage door is stuck halfway due to a motor failure, a simple motor swap may not be the only solution. For a standard single-car garage door, the average installation cost typically ranges from $800 to $1,500, while a double-car door often falls between $1,200 and $2,500. These figures include both the door unit and professional labor. The final price depends heavily on material, insulation, and custom features. Steel doors are the most budget-friendly, while wood or custom designs increase the expense significantly. Homeowners insurance typically covers a new garage door only if the damage is caused by a covered peril, such as a storm, fire, vehicle impact, or vandalism. Standard wear and tear, rust, or age-related deterioration are not covered. If a tree falls on your door or a burglar damages it during a break-in, your policy's dwelling or other structures coverage may apply, minus your deductible. For a precise assessment of your specific policy, you should review your coverage details or speak with your agent. For homeowners in the Atlanta area with less-than-perfect credit, replacing a garage door is still achievable through several flexible financing routes. Many local providers, including Atlanta Garage Doors, often partner with third-party lenders that specialize in credit-challenged applicants. These lenders may offer secured loans where the new door itself acts as collateral, or they might provide in-house payment plans with manageable monthly installments. Another practical option is a personal loan from a credit union, which typically offers more favorable terms than a bank. Additionally, some manufacturers run seasonal promotions with deferred interest or low introductory rates that do not require a high credit score. Before committing, always review the total cost, including any origination fees or APR, to ensure the terms fit your budget.
